Каким способом поддерживается корректность работы программных систем
Стабильность функционирования программных решений выступает фундаментальным условием к любому цифровому решению. Независимо к масштаба решения — от простого прикладного инструмента до сложной распределенной архитектуры — приложение необходимо чтобы исполнять описанные возможности стабильно, последовательно и без ошибок выхода. Гарантирование устойчивости не ограничивается реализацией исполняемого программного решения. Это admiral x комплексный механизм, содержащий проектирование, валидацию, контроль данных, отслеживание и непрерывную поддержку, что глубоко освещается в исследовательских публикациях адмирал казино.
Приложение исполняется в заданной среде выполнения: системная система, аппаратные мощности, инфраструктурное окружение, сторонние сервисы. Любое даже незначительное обновление указанных условий в состоянии повлиять на логику программы. Следовательно правильность рассматривается не только как минимизация ошибок в реализации, но и как готовность решения поддерживать корректность в разнообразных условиях работы.
Четкое описание ожиданий и проектное описание
Поддержание правильности начинается существенно раньше прежде чем создания программы. На начальном шаге создается проектное задание, где фиксируются возможности приложения, сценарии применения, пределы а также предполагаемые итоги. Четко зафиксированные критерии помогают избежать неоднозначностей и логических конфликтов в реализации.
Критически важно описать предельные параметры, нестандартные режимы а также приемлемые погрешности. В случае если критерии сохраняются абстрактными, корректность превращается субъективной оценкой. Формализация условий делает возможной объективную валидацию выполнения программы ожиданиям адмирал х.
Дополнительно формируются функциональные сценарии а также диаграммы процессов, описывающие последовательность шагов в пределах программы. Подобные схемы позволяют выявлять структурные несоответствия задолго до начала реализации а также исправлять архитектуру будущего продукта.
Проектирование структуры а также логики программы
Продуманно спроектированная структура существенно уменьшает риск сбоев. Декомпозиция программы на независимые блоки, применение подходов разграничения и ограничение зависимостей среди частями укрепляют надежность системы. Изолированные модули удобнее анализировать и модифицировать без разрушения глобальной архитектуры.
Четкая структура программы упрощает сопровождение и анализ. Использование логичных обозначений переменных admiral-x, а также также придерживание единых правил реализации минимизирует вероятность латентных структурных сбоев.
Дополнительным плюсом является способность развития проекта. В случае если модули системы слабо связаны, их возможно модифицировать независимо, обеспечивая общую управляемость решения.
Предварительный анализ а также аудит кода
Перед внедрения приложения в работу осуществляется оценка реализации. Статический анализ находит возможные ошибки, отклонения правил а также некорректные фрагменты. Программные инструменты admiral x помогают фиксировать распространенные дефекты на предварительном уровне.
Проверка реализации со стороны других экспертов даёт возможность выявить функциональные неточности, что могут быть незаметными для автора алгоритма. Коллективная проверка увеличивает корректность программы и обеспечивает согласованность проектных решений.
В процессе аудита также оценивается понятность а также расширяемость реализации, поскольку это значимо для длительной эксплуатации а также предотвращения увеличения архитектурных дефектов.
Комплексное валидация
Тестирование считается главным механизмом обеспечения стабильности. Юнит испытания адмирал х проверяют конкретные блоки, интеграционные — работу среди частями, системные — работу системы в полном объеме. Подобный комплексный подход обеспечивает полную валидацию надежности.
Ключевое значение имеют тесты на крайние значения и нештатные режимы. Дефекты часто обнаруживаются при обработке с пограничными значениями, при отсутствии входных значений а также при нестандартных форматах поступающей параметров.
Параллельно применяются повторные тесты, что проверить, что новые обновления не нарушили ранее модули системы. Данный подход admiral-x обеспечивает надежность в рамках обновления программы.
Валидация поступающих параметров
Программа должна корректно обрабатывать поступающие значения безотносительно от их источника. Проверка типа, границ показателей и required элементов снижает проведение неверных вычислений. Контроль оберегает приложение от функциональных сбоев а также нестабильного поведения.
Дополнительно к тому же, важно реализовать защиту от умышленно ошибочных параметров. Фильтрация и проверка содержания поступающих параметров исключают нарушение стабильности программы.
Периодическая проверка корректности наборов admiral x позволяет обеспечивать надежность механизмов обработки а также повышает достоверность выходов функционирования системы.
Контроль исключений
Даже с учётом детальном тестировании целиком предотвратить появление ошибок нельзя. Поэтому программа обязана содержать инструменты перехвата исключений. В случае проявлении сбоя система необходимо чтобы или безопасно остановить процесс, либо вернуться в безопасное формат.
Логирование ошибок даёт возможность разбирать причины нарушений а также устранять их в последующих версиях. Отсутствие эффективной системы управления исключений способно вызвать к цепным нарушениям в исполнении системы.
Понятные уведомления адмирал х о сбоях помогают быстрее определять проблемы и ускоряют сопровождение системы.
Управление устойчивости
Корректность подразумевает не лишь верность операций, одновременно также способность выполнения в долгосрочной перспективе. Приложение должна адекватно исполняться в разнообразных объемах операций, не допуская потерь памяти, блокировок либо падения эффективности.
Нагрузочное тестирование позволяет распознать узкие точки а также оценить работу системы при экстремальной активности запросов. Настройка ресурсов гарантирует стабильность функционирования в продолжительной работе.
Постоянный анализ показателей даёт возможность оперативно выявлять признаки ухудшения работы и минимизировать отказы.
Отслеживание после эксплуатации
Даже при развертывания программы требуется непрерывный контроль. Наблюдение позволяет анализировать основные метрики: частоту сбоев, скорость отклика, потребление процессора. Анализ подобных данных позволяет заранее обнаруживать отклонения.
Оперативное устранение на аномальные сигналы предотвращает развитие крупных проблем и поддерживает стабильность функционирования в эксплуатационных условиях admiral-x.
Параллельно используются механизмы алертов, что оповещать разработчиков о важных ошибках в режиме реального момента.
Контроль изменений
Обновление приложения неизбежно включает с добавлением обновлений. Внедрение механизмов контроля версий позволяет фиксировать все модификацию а также анализировать её эффект на стабильность. Такая практика ускоряет восстановление к проверенному релизу в обнаружении сбоев.
Поэтапное внедрение версий а также обязательное проверка новой сборки позволяют поддерживать корректность программы и предотвратить критических сбоев.
Журнал обновлений является средством анализа развития проекта а также помогает выявлять типовые сбои.
Безопасность в роли элемент корректности
Нарушение защищенности в состоянии спровоцировать к подмене информации а также некорректной функционированию системы. Поэтому контроль доступа от стороннего вмешательства, контроль прав пользователей и системное актуализация компонентов являются основой обеспечения надежности admiral x.
Криптографическая защита и мониторинг сетевых соединений снижают сторонние нарушения, которые повлиять поведение системы.
Периодические оценки защитных механизмов позволяют выявлять уязвимости до того, когда эти проблемы спровоцируют к критическим нарушениям.
Поддержка
Подробная спецификация облегчает развитие приложения а также минимизирует вероятность некорректных изменений в расширении. Документирование логики работы позволяет дополнительным специалистам быстро разбираться в кодовой базе системы.
Периодическое актуализация инструкций обеспечивает соответствие текущему уровню системы а также обеспечивает корректность в процессе их обновления.
Грамотно оформленные руководства кроме того упрощают внедрение новых модулей адмирал х а также ускоряют адаптацию пользователей.
Вывод
Корректность работы приложений обеспечивается многоуровневым процессом, охватывающим точную постановку задач, продуманную реализацию, проверку, мониторинг и управление обновлениями. Данный подход admiral-x выступает постоянным механизмом, поддерживающим каждый эксплуатационный путь решения.
Именно связка технической аккуратности, комплексного анализа и постоянного мониторинга позволяет обеспечивать предсказуемость цифровых продуктов в условиях меняющейся эксплуатации.